Glasgow done, all eyes on 'Amdavad 2030': India's campaign offers both promise and warning signs

in5points
  1. India won 39 medals at the Glasgow 2026 Commonwealth Games, fewer than the 61 in Birmingham 2022, 66 in Gold Coast 2018, and 64 in Glasgow 2014.

  2. Medals came from just six sports because Glasgow did not include shooting, wrestling, hockey, badminton, archery, or table tennis.

  3. Athletics contributed 16 medals, including silver for Gulveer Singh in the 10,000m and bronze in the 5,000m, and bronze for Tejaswin Shankar in the decathlon.

  4. Yash Vir Singh won a javelin bronze, and para-athletes added three gold, two silver, and one bronze.

  5. India will host the Commonwealth Games in Ahmedabad ('Amdavad 2030'), aiming to improve on the record 101 medals from Delhi 2010.
